I understand you can book a future cruise onboard for someone who is not onboard.

 

But is it possible to book a cruise the other person using their credit card (not physically having their credit card, but having all the required information from it). Or do you have to pay for their deposit using your own credit card?

Link to comment
Share on other sites

I do it for my family online since the name on the booking and credit card are the same. My guess is they will allow you. Are you doing it onboard for the perks? You may want to photocopy the other person's credit card and driver's license in case they ask you.
